Physics Question on Refraction of Light
An isosceles prism of angle 120∘ has a refractive index 1.44. Two parallel rays of monochromatic light enter the prism parallel to each other in air as shown. The rays emerging from the opposite face
A
are parallel to each other
B
are diverging
C
make an angle 2[sin−1(0.72)−30∘] with each other
D
with each other 2sin−1(0.72) with each other
Answer
make an angle 2[sin−1(0.72)−30∘] with each other
Explanation
Solution
The diagramatic representation of the given problem is
shown in figure.
From figure it follows that ∠i=∠A=30∘
From Snell's law, n1sini=n2 sin r
or \hspace15mm sin r=\frac{1.44 sin 30^\circ}{1}=0.72
Now, ∠δ=∠r−∠i=sin−1(0.72)−30∘
∴θ=2(∠δ)=2sin−1(0.72)−30∘
